If you’re having a hard time seeing the road to your perfect home, keep reading for the order we often recommend handling renovations when you’re planning for multiple projects.
Fix Roof, Walls, and Ceilings
If your fixer upper requires substantial repairs to the roof, ceilings, or walls–or if you’re reimagining the layout–this often makes sense to handle prior to move in. It’s important to make sure the shell of your home is stable before remodeling the inside of the home. Logistically, ceiling repairs (including removing popcorn ceilings) can be messy, so it’s often easier to handle minus furniture.
Install New Flooring
Installing new flooring in your fixer upper is also high priority for the same reason. If you’re replacing the flooring in a large portion of the house it’s generally much easier to do prior to moving furniture in. This project is also one that will greatly increase your enjoyment of the home while boosting its value.
Service Your A/C
Especially in Florida, it’s important to make sure your A/C is working before moving in. You don’t want to be carrying furniture through a home without air conditioning! Especially if you’re moving during the summer months, this could cause a health hazard.
Upgrade the Bathroom
Since the bathroom is a smaller area, this is a room you can remodel at a lower cost and then use that feeling of accomplishment to fuel your next project. Making your bathroom feel luxurious is a great way to treat yourself and simultaneously boost the value of your fixer upper. Upgrades like a walk-in shower, freestanding tub, new vanity, and fresh tile will breathe new life into the space and provide the features that future buyers will be looking for. Some smaller updates that you can make include adding backlit LED mirrors, freshening things up with a coat of paint, and upgrading fixtures like shower heads, cabinet handles, and faucets.
Renovate the Kitchen
A complete kitchen renovation is something that can generally wait, but is a project that will bring so much functionality and value to an outdated home. The kitchen is truly the heart of your home, you use it every day for cooking meals, and it’s an area people tend to congregate when you’re entertaining. Adding a kitchen island creates so much space for daily tasks and a new area for guests to gather. Combining this with an upgrade to granite or quartz countertops will bring a luxurious feel to the space while also allowing you to benefit from features like high heat resistance, durability, and low maintenance. Replacing or painting your cabinetry will really tie the space together, while items like a new sink and faucet will modernize the look while also bringing ease to regular tasks. Touchless faucets are a great example of how a small upgrade can add so much convenience to your day.
Switch out the Windows
Changing your windows out may have a high upfront cost, but if you have an older home it will save you money monthly on your energy bill. Living in Florida, upgrading to hurricane-impact windows can also offer peace of mind in a storm.
